Review of the EB5 Program
The EB5 Immigrant Investor Program works as an essential path for foreign nationals looking for long-term residency in the USA via financial investment. Established by the Immigration Act of 1990, this program intends to boost the united state economic climate by drawing in foreign funding and developing jobs for American workers. The program needs capitalists to contribute a minimum of $1 million to a new company, or $500,000 if the investment is made in a targeted employment location (TEA), which is generally characterized by high joblessness or country status.The EB5 program is developed to advertise economic development and work development, with the expectation that each financial investment will certainly create a minimum of ten full-time tasks for united state workers. Investors might select to invest straight in an organization or through a Regional Facility, which is a company designated by USCIS to promote financial investment tasks. Regional Centers frequently offer a more streamlined procedure and can handle the intricacies of task creation and compliance with program requirements.Moreover, the EB5 program offers financiers with the possibility to get conditional permanent residency on their own and their immediate member of the family, consisting of partners and youngsters under 21. After meeting the financial investment and task development requirements, financiers can use to have the problems removed, resulting in full long-term residency. As necessary, the EB5 Immigrant Financier Program not just works as a considerable economic engine for the USA, however likewise supplies international nationals a viable path to a new life in America.
Eligibility Requirements
To get approved for the EB5 Immigrant Capitalist Program, applicants should meet specific eligibility needs that show their dedication to purchasing the U.S. economic situation. The foundational requirement is that financiers must make a minimum investment of $1 million in a qualifying brand-new industrial business or $500,000 in a targeted work area (TEA), which is specified as a rural area or a location with high unemployment. This investment has to be at threat and made use of for task development in the U.S.Additionally, applicants must confirm that they have legitimately acquired the funds for their investment. This involves providing complete paperwork of the source of the investment funding, including income tax return, bank declarations, and any type of other pertinent financial records. The funds can be derived from various sources, consisting of personal cost savings, service revenues, or gifts, offered they are traceable and lawfully obtained.Moreover, the capitalist has to demonstrate their intent to create or maintain a minimum of ten full-time jobs for united state workers within 2 years of their financial investment. This job production demand is a crucial facet of the program, as it aims to stimulate financial growth and work.

Step-by-Step Treatment
Steering the application procedure for the EB5 Immigrant Financier Program requires careful interest to information and adherence to certain protocols. The primary step involves choosing an ideal financial investment job, usually within an assigned regional center, which fulfills the minimum financial investment limit of $1 million or $500,000 in targeted employment areas.Once a project is chosen, the next action is to full Type I-526, the Immigrant Request by Alien Investor. This kind needs documents to demonstrate the source of the mutual fund, business strategy, and the expected task production - EB5 Minimum Capital Requirement. It is vital to provide extensive and exact financial disclosures to stay clear of delays or denials.After approval of Type I-526, applicants can continue to the next stage, which consists of filing Form DS-260, the Application for Immigrant Visa and Alien Registration, if outside the United States, or Form I-485, Modification of Condition, if already in the U.S. This step includes biometric appointments and interviews
